Zen Group, Inc., et al v. State of Florida Agency for Health Care Administra, et al
Plaintiff / Appellant: ZEN GROUP, INC. and CARLOS OTAMENDI
Defendant / Appellee: STATE OF FLORIDA AGENCY FOR HEALTH CARE ADMINISTRATION, SECRETARY, STATE OF FLORIDA, AGENCY FOR HEALTH CARE ADMINISTRATION, KELLY BENNETT, individually and in her official capacity as Chief of the Office of Medicaid Program Integrity within the State of Florida, Agency for Health Care Administration and SHEVAUN HARRIS
Case Number: 22-10319
Filed: January 31, 2022
Court: U.S. Court of Appeals, Eleventh Circuit
Nature of Suit: Other Civil Rights
